Error: org.apache.hive.jdbc.ZooKeeperHiveClientException: Unable to read HiveServer2 configs from ZooKeeper
时间: 2024-05-18 16:11:21 浏览: 15
这个错误通常是由于 HiveServer2 无法从 ZooKeeper 获取配置信息导致的。可能的原因包括:
1. ZooKeeper 未启动或不可用,需要确认 ZooKeeper 是否已正确启动并且可以访问。
2. HiveServer2 配置错误,需要检查配置文件中的参数是否正确。
3. 防火墙或网络问题,需要确认网络连接是否正常并且端口是否被防火墙阻止。
4. HiveServer2 与 ZooKeeper 版本不匹配,需要确认 HiveServer2 和 ZooKeeper 的版本是否一致。
建议您检查以上几个方面,以便解决这个问题。
相关问题
org.apache.hive.jdbc.ZooKeeperHiveClientException: Unable to read HiveServer2 configs from ZooKeeper
这个错误可能是由于无法从ZooKeeper中读取HiveServer2配置而引起的。你可以尝试以下步骤来解决这个问题:
1. 检查ZooKeeper是否正在运行,以及HiveServer2是否已正确注册到ZooKeeper中。
2. 检查HiveServer2的配置文件中是否已正确配置ZooKeeper连接信息。
3. 确保HiveServer2的版本与ZooKeeper版本兼容。
4. 如果以上步骤都没有解决问题,考虑在HiveServer2和ZooKeeper之间使用较低级别的网络调试工具,例如telnet或netcat,以确保网络连接正常。
java.lang.ClassNotFoundException: org.apache.hadoop.hive.jdbc.HiveDriver
这个错误是由于找不到 Hive JDBC 驱动程序所导致的。要解决这个问题,您可以按照以下步骤进行操作:
1. 确保您已经安装了 Hive 并设置了正确的环境变量。
2. 检查您的项目的依赖项配置文件(例如 Maven 或 Gradle 构建文件),确保已经正确添加了 Hive JDBC 驱动程序的依赖项。例如,在 Maven 中,您可以添加以下依赖项:
```xml
<dependency>
<groupId>org.apache.hive</groupId>
<artifactId>hive-jdbc</artifactId>
<version>3.1.2</version>
</dependency>
```
3. 如果您正在使用 IDE 进行开发,确保将 Hive JDBC 驱动程序的 JAR 文件添加到您的项目的构建路径中。您可以手动下载 Hive JDBC 驱动程序的 JAR 文件,然后将其添加到您的项目中。
4. 如果您正在使用命令行进行编译和运行,请确保在编译和运行命令中包含 Hive JDBC 驱动程序的路径。例如,在使用 javac 编译 Java 代码时,可以使用以下命令:
```bash
javac -cp /path/to/hive-jdbc.jar YourJavaFile.java
```
请注意,上面的 `/path/to/hive-jdbc.jar` 应替换为实际的 Hive JDBC 驱动程序的路径。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)